Air Destratifier: The Essential Ally for Large Industrial Volumes

An air destratifier is an essential tool for large spaces: it forces heat stored in the ceiling down to the floor to even out the temperature. This energy performance solution eliminates cold spots and optimizes the efficiency of your air heaters by breaking up the thermal gradient.

Common mistakes? Forgetting to regulate the system with high/low probes, undersizing the air circulation flow, and placing fans too close to cold walls. When properly installed, it guarantees an ROI in less than two seasons—provided that the building's air volume is circulated 2 to 3 times per hour.

The air destratifier is the most cost-effective equipment for any company with high-ceiling premises (warehouses, gyms, hangars, reception halls). In a building over 4 meters high, thermal physics imposes a simple and costly rule: hot air, being lighter, rises and accumulates under the roof, while cold air stagnates at ground level. This phenomenon, known as thermal stratification, leads to colossal energy waste. Understanding the phenomenon of thermal stratification

To understand the usefulness of an air destratifier, one must examine the temperature gradient. In an unequipped industrial building, a temperature increase of 1°C to 1.5°C per meter of height is generally observed.

The thermal assessment

If you want to maintain a temperature of 18°C on the ground for your operators in an 8-meter high hangar, it will probably be more than 28°C under the ceiling.

  • Direct consequence: You are heating an unnecessary volume of air.

  • Increased heat loss: The heat accumulated at the top escapes faster through the roof (often the least insulated wall), forcing your hot air generator to run continuously.

1. How does an air destratifier work?

An air destratifier is not just a fan. It is a thermal turbine designed to circulate air vertically and in a controlled manner.

The heat recovery cycle

The device, fixed at the highest point of the building, draws in the hot air accumulated under the roof and gently propels it downwards. This airflow "breaks" the thermal layers and mixes the hot air from the top with the cool air from the bottom.

  • Uniformization: The temperature difference between the floor and the ceiling is reduced to only 1 or 2°C.

  • Regulation: The thermostats of your heating devices (air heaters, radiant heaters) detect this temperature rise at ground level and switch off much faster.

Massive energy savings

By recovering heat lost at the ceiling, you reduce the need for thermal production from your boiler or hot air generators.

The Climatik key figure: Heating savings are estimated to be between 20% and 35% depending on the building's height and insulation.

Protection of stock and building

In logistics warehouses, stratification can harm the preservation of certain heat-sensitive products stored at height (pharmaceuticals, food). Furthermore, by homogenizing the air, the destratifier limits the risks of condensation on metal structures and the roof, extending the building's lifespan.

3. Choosing the right type of destratifier with Climatik

There are several technologies of air destratifiers, and the choice depends on the configuration of your premises.

Turbine destratifiers (Ducted fans)

These are compact devices with a casing that channels the airflow into a narrow cone. They are perfect for very high ceilings (up to 20 meters) because they have a significant projection range.

  • Usage: High-bay storage warehouses, factories.

HVLS (High Volume Low Speed) destratifiers

These are huge ceiling fans (up to 7 meters in diameter) that rotate slowly. They move a colossal mass of air at very low speed.

  • Usage: Shopping centers, gyms, livestock buildings.

  • Summer advantage: They are also very effective for cooling in summer by creating a light breeze.

Implementation and sizing

A destratification project does not consist of randomly installing fans. At Climatik, we conduct a flow study to optimize efficiency.

The air circulation rate rule

For effective destratification, the air volume circulated per hour must be approximately 2 to 3 times the total volume of the building.

Dtotal = Vbuilding x 3

Strategic positioning

Destratifiers must be placed:

  1. Above main work areas.

  2. Away from cold walls or loading dock doors to avoid drawing in cold air.

  3. At a height that allows capture of the warmest air layer (approximately 50 cm below the ceiling).

The little Climatik plus for summer:

Did you know that your destratifiers are useful all year round? In summer, by increasing their rotation speed, they provide an immediate feeling of freshness to occupants thanks to wind chill, without consuming the energy of air conditioning.
